Uh, couple of caveats before we get too far into this. Be aware that the support for STM32based hardware has been removed. That means that all those people who were out there pioneering this with things like the FR Sky R9M hardware and other bits and pieces, you know what? You're kind of going to have to stick with the versions that you are on. It looks like Express LS 4.0 is leaving that legacy behind.

So, let's go through this in no particular order. I'm just going to go through it as it appears here. Actually, you know what? No, I'm not. I'm going to go through this one first. Channel 5. Now, historically, channel 5 has needed to be in a high position in order to turn on all the goodness, dynamic power, and other bits and pieces. And although you could turn those things off, lots of pilots when they were using the Express LRS technology with older stabilizers over things like SBUS didn't really appreciate this and we're getting lousy range and performance issues because channel 5 wasn't high. We now have the ability to move it to another physical or logical switch and put it on another channel. So, if you are using an old style stabilizer or maybe one of the OM hobby modern stabilizers in your helicopter or whatever, going to 4.0 is finally going to fix that issue. You are still going to have to have an arming channel. That could be logical so that when you move the throttle off the very lowest position, it's armed or whatever you want to do. But now we have that flexibility. For me, I would probably just move it out the way and put it on channel 11 or 12. And that way, then I can use channel five for whatever gain mode or whatever it is on those pieces of older technology that need channel 5 to be something other than a binary position channel.

The next one then that I'll talk about and I'll I'll kind of zoom down because it's kind of hidden at the bottom, but this is this is kind of big news. LR1121 has been in it's the technology the transceiver technology inside a lot of the modern radios. So things like the Radio Master TX16S Mark III things like the GS GX12 lots of modern radios are using this new technology and with Express LRS 4.0 we actually get access to a new 20 packet modes. [snorts] So, this allows us to unlock all of the performance of those LR1121based transceivers that are in these newer radios. So, if you have one of these newer radios, you know what? It's probably worthwhile you're looking at potentially playing around with this so that when you're playing with the different modes, then you get the maximum performance. But they're saying here that this is the whole reason that 4.0 zero needed to happen, but it's nowhere near the top of the list of things that they've changed, which I think is quite interesting.

The next one to talk about then is automatic CH antenna modes. I've done videos about this in the past about whether or not it's things like uh diversity or whether it's Gemini mode or all those other kind of different bits and pieces. It's confused a load of people. The cool thing is as of 4.0, zero. It's all going to automatically be selected between true diversity and Gemini mode based on the transmitter setting. It's all going to be set automatically. You don't have to mess around with this to try and figure out which mode you need on your radio for the particular receiver that you've got and how you've got it set up.

Next one to talk about then is they have expanded the PWM receiver ranges. So if you are using PWM receivers in your car, boat, plane, or whatever, you can now go the full range from 500 to 2500 microsconds to drive the servos to their maximum position if that's been a problem for you historically. And [snorts] they've also increased the fail safe a [clears throat] little bit outside that range by about 23 microsconds from 476 to 2523. So that means that any servo based craft, cars, boats, wings, planes, radiocontrol trucks, whatever it is, now gives you that little bit more latitude to drive the servo to the very extremes of its position.

Next one to talk about then is the adapt adaptive dynamic power. This is a quite a nice change. There's actually a lot of changes inside 4.0 zero about how the communication happens between the radio and the receiver and vice versa and how it uses that communication to improve the performance of the link. This is a nice one where it means that um it this majorly improves the power for things like the 1121 systems I've already mentioned which means that you're not going to be going to full blast output as often. It's a lot smarter in this new firmware for those adaptive dynamic power systems so that it's not just turning on the tap all the time when it thinks there might be a problem.

The other nice thing is there has improved telemetry rates. So whether you're operating in Gemini mode and you have multiple antennas or whether it's a single antenna, there is an improvement in the telemetry bandwidth that we're getting back. Now this is big news. If you want to do things like get Mavink telemetry back to the radio or you're passing the telemetry back to some kind of ground station and trying to use it, I have been very disappointed historically with the telemetry bandwidth and 4.0 addresses that. So, it means that with Gemini mode, we're going to get a lot more and even if you only have a single antenna, you're going to get about a 30% increase in in bandwidth. So telemetry times are going to uh be reduced because the bandwidth has gone up. So if you are playing a lot with telemetry, this is fantastic news.

The back pack has got a lot smarter as well. So um it supports sending data to HTX instead. So that means that you could potentially use devices like this foot pedal to control stuff, which potentially opens the door to lots of rigs that you could have that quite complicated that actually connect into the radio via the backpack and be used for control. That's a great idea.

The next one is quite cool. So they've got a new DJI output protocol. So, if you have a DJI uh VTX inside your model, the way it works, as you're probably aware, is that it's in low power state until you arm the model. The flight controller would then send an armed status via the telemetry link that is connected to and then that would go to whichever power you have set. That now can be done directly from Express LRS. Um I'm hoping that this also means that it's going to work for things like HD0 and Walk 2. If I get a chance, I might try it. If you've already tried it and found that it works on things like Walknell, I'd be really interested. I know lots of pilots who would love this to have their HD FPV system go to full power automatically without having to mess around adding something like a flight controller with Betafly, INAV, or even something like that Sparrow Pro that we looked at last summer.

You can add uh NMEA based GPS to the system which is going to be interesting for those of you that want that going to be see whether or not people are going to bring out specific ones. There are more robust syncing options which have been uh improved. So rather than some of the weirdness that you could get when it syncs that's all been sorted out and there's loads of other changes as well. The only downside I guess is that with this stuff as with a lot of this is that every time we have a major increase like now we're at Express RS version 4.0. It means that you cannot bind or they not definitely don't support you binding to an express LRS4 receiver with a radio that's running 36 or something else and vice versa. So if you want to use this then you've got to update your radio and you've got to update your entire receiver fleet. Back in the days of things like Crossfire that was really easy because it was all overtheair update stuff. So the first time you connected then that would automatically be detected and work that out.

So for me, there's only two things left in this project that I wish it had. One is to build in some backward compatibility potentially on the radio side so that it could listen and try and negotiate with a receiver to at least give us N minus one compatibility. So a version five setup of Express LRS will allow both version five and version four radios to connect to receivers. That would be amazing. And the other thing is to have some kind of overthe-air updates that worked seamlessly like the old Crossfire days. And that way when you updated your radio, it would just automatically update all the receivers. I guess that's tricky because everyone is making their own hardware. You'd have to have all of the targets stored in the radio, but I can wish, right?
